Graphing Culture Change in North American Archaeology: A History of Graph Types
Lyman, R. Lee (Professor Emeritus, Professor Emeritus, University of Missouri-Columbia)
North American archaeologists have grappled with finding a graph that effectively and efficiently displays culture change over time. This volume explores the history of graphing culture change, and brings graph theory, construction, and decipherment to the forefront of archaeological discussion.
